De'Aaron Fox could miss Game 5 of the Sacramento Kings' first-round NBA playoff series against the Golden State Warriors due to a fractured finger, according to reports
Despite the injury, Fox played the remainder of the game and even hit a clutch 3-pointer with less than a minute to play to pull the Kings within one.

The Kings will struggle to replace that production if he can't go in Game 5 on Wednesday. The series is set to return to Chase Center in San Francisco on Friday.
